Anem a comprovar en aquest apartat que fortran s’ha instal·lat correctament. Per a fer-ho compilarem un programa de prova.
Ves a els teus Documents o a l’Escriptori o a on vulguis i crea una carpeta que s’anomeni “Fortran” o “Compu” o “Programes” o “Practiques Compu” o per l’estil, aquest contindrà tots els teus programes.
Assegura’t que pots veure les extensions dels fitxers (En l’explorador d’arxius cliques “Visualització”, “Mostra”, “Extensions del nom del fitxer”)
Crea-hi un arxiu anomenat “prova.f90”, per a fer-ho fas:
{botó dret} → Nuevo → Documento de texto (arxiu .txt) → li poses de nom “prova.f90"
→ al haver canviat l’extensió de .txt a f.90 et dirà Seguro? li dius Sí
→ entres al arxiu (Abrir con → Más aplicaciones → Libreta o Bloc de notas (de moment))
→ copies i enganxes el codi que tens aquí sota → Guardes l’arxiu
program helloWorld
implicit none
print *, 'Hello World!'
end program
Obres la Terminal o cmd o Símbolo de Sistema o PowerShell (buscant pel nom a baix al buscador de Windows o per exemple fent Win+R i escrivint ‘cmd’).
Et mous mitjançant els comandaments “cd [carpeta]”, “cd..” i “dir” fins a la carpeta on tens el teu programa.
Compiles des de la terminal fent:
gfortran prova.f90 -o prova.exe
S’hauria d’haver creat un fitxer “prova.exe”, executa’l fent:
.\\prova.exe
Alternativament ves a la carpeta i executa’l manualment (clicant-lo dos cops).
Si llegeixes un Hello World! a la terminal felicitats, has instal·lat bé el fortran i ja saps compilar i executar des de la terminal.
Una altra manera de comprovar que s’han instal·lat correctament fortran i gnuplot, seria escriure en la terminal gfortran --version
i us hauria de retornar la versió. I després gnuplot --version
, i també hauria de retornar la versió.
Crea un fitxer i anomena’l “dades.dat” i enganxa-hi les següents dades:
1 1
2 4
3 9
4 16
5 25
6 36
7 49
8 64
9 81
Crea un fitxer anomena’t “fig1.gnu” i enganxa-hi el següent codi:
file = 'dades.dat'
set term png
set out 'fig1.png'
plot file
Des de la terminal, genera el gràfic fent:
gnuplot fig1.gnu
A la carpeta se’t hauria d’haver generat un fitxer “fig1.png”, obre la imatge i mira si és similar a aquesta: